Claude Code汉化教程:让AI自己翻译自己的零门槛方案

开源项目让Claude Code利用AI能力自主完成界面中文汉化
开源项目Qt Cloud Hoax提供了一种创新的Claude Code汉化方案:将包含151个翻译词条的项目代码交给Claude Code,让AI自主读取翻译字典并替换本地文件中的英文文本,实现界面全中文化。该方案还提供Hook脚本实现100+命令的中文实时提示。由于是AI自适应执行,不存在版本兼容问题,更新后重新运行即可恢复汉化。
Claude Code全英文界面的使用痛点
Claude Code 作为 Anthropic 推出的 AI 编程工具,功能强大但界面全英文,对国内开发者尤其是新手来说存在不小的使用门槛。与 GitHub Copilot 等代码补全工具不同,Claude Code 是一款运行在终端环境中的命令行 AI 编程助手,具备完整的 agentic coding 能力——它可以自主浏览代码库、编辑文件、执行终端命令、管理 Git 操作,甚至处理复杂的多步骤开发任务。这种 agent 模式意味着 Claude Code 不仅仅是一个被动的代码建议工具,而是一个能主动理解上下文并采取行动的编程代理。正因为它基于命令行界面(CLI),所有的交互提示、状态信息和命令说明都以纯文本形式呈现,从欢迎语到配置面板,从快捷键到命令说明,满屏英文让不少人望而却步。
最近,一个名为 Qt Cloud Hoax 的开源项目提供了一个巧妙的思路——不需要你手动翻译,而是让 Claude Code"自己汉化自己"。这个方案的精髓在于:把开源项目的代码作为"汉化说明书"交给 Claude Code,让 AI 自己完成所有翻译和替换工作。

汉化核心原理:让 AI 读懂翻译字典
一句话触发完整汉化流程
整个操作流程极其简单。你只需要把 Qt Cloud Hoax 的 GitHub 地址发给 Claude Code,然后说一句:
"参照这个项目的代码,帮我汉化。"
Claude Code 拿到这个项目后,会自动执行以下步骤:
- 读取翻译字典:项目中包含一份完整的翻译字典,涵盖 151 个词条,从欢迎语到配置面板,从快捷键到命令说明,覆盖了 Claude Code 界面中几乎所有常见的英文文本。
- 检查本地 NPM 包文件:Claude Code 会自动定位自己安装目录下的相关文件。Claude Code 通过 npm(Node Package Manager)全局安装在用户系统中,其核心代码以 JavaScript/TypeScript 编译后的形式存储在 node_modules 目录下。界面上显示的所有文本字符串——欢迎语、菜单项、提示信息——都硬编码在这些本地 JavaScript 文件中。汉化的本质就是定位这些字符串并进行文本替换,由于是本地文件,修改后立即生效,无需重新编译。
- 逐一替换:按照字典中的对照关系,逐个完成文本替换。
改完之后打开 Claude Code,你会看到"Welcome back"变成了"欢迎回来","Auto Compact"变成了"自动压缩",配置面板、斜杠命令、快捷键提示全部变成中文。
为什么不存在版本兼容问题?
这个方案有一个天然优势:是你自己的 Claude Code 在改自己的文件。它完全清楚自己当前版本的文件结构和内容位置,不存在传统汉化补丁常见的版本不兼容问题。不管你用的是哪个版本的 Claude Code,它都知道该怎么改。
这与传统的"制作汉化包 → 用户下载 → 覆盖文件"的模式完全不同。传统软件汉化通常遵循逆向工程的路径:汉化者需要反编译目标软件、定位资源文件中的字符串、制作翻译对照表、重新打包并分发汉化补丁。这种模式高度依赖特定版本的文件结构,一旦软件更新,汉化补丁往往立即失效。而 Claude Code 的方案本质上是一种 AI 驱动的自适应汉化——将翻译知识(字典)与执行能力(AI agent)分离。字典提供"翻译什么"的知识,AI 负责"怎么翻译"的执行。由于 AI 能够理解代码结构和上下文语义,即使文件路径变化或字符串位置调整,它也能智能定位并完成替换,这本质上是将确定性的查找替换升级为具备理解能力的智能适配。
进阶功能:100+命令的中文实时提示
除了界面汉化,Qt Cloud Hoax 还提供了第二个实用功能——中文命令提示。
项目中包含一个 Hook 脚本,安装后 Claude Code 每执行一个操作,都会自动显示一行中文解释。Hook(钩子)是一种常见的软件设计模式,允许用户在特定事件发生时插入自定义逻辑。在 Claude Code 中,Hook 可以在命令执行前后触发用户定义的脚本——这类似于 Git Hooks 的工作方式,Git 允许在 commit、push 等操作前后执行自定义脚本。具体到中文命令提示功能,其原理是:当 Claude Code 准备执行一个 shell 命令时,Hook 脚本会拦截该命令,在预设的命令-释义映射表中查找对应的中文说明,然后将其输出到终端。例如:
git push→ "推送代码到远程仓库"npm install→ "管理项目依赖"
项目覆盖了 100 多个常用命令,每个都配有中文说明。这对新手来说意义重大——你终于能实时看懂 Claude Code 在干什么了,而不是面对一堆英文命令不知所措。
Hook 脚本配置注意事项
每个人的电脑环境不一样,Windows 和 Mac 的路径不同,Bash 配置也存在差异。NPM 全局安装的包在不同系统中存储路径各异:macOS 通常位于 /usr/local/lib/node_modules 或通过 nvm 管理的 ~/.nvm 目录下,Windows 则在 %AppData%/npm/node_modules 路径中。Hook 脚本通常以 shell script(.sh)或 JavaScript 形式编写,需要正确配置文件路径和执行权限才能正常工作。建议在配置 Hook 脚本时,让 Claude Code 帮你检查 Hook 配置,根据你自己的电脑环境做调整,这样运行起来更稳定。
这个汉化方案值得推荐的三个理由
开源项目已经帮你踩完了坑
自己从零开始汉化 Claude Code,你需要搞清楚:151 个词条怎么翻译?哪些文件需要修改?怎么备份?怎么恢复?这些问题在 Qt Cloud Hoax 的代码里都已经有了答案。
让 Claude Code 读取这个项目,等于给了它一份详尽的"汉化说明书",照着做就能少走很多弯路。这也体现了一个有趣的范式:用开源社区的经验积累作为 AI 的参考知识,让 AI 来执行具体操作。
MIT 协议,完全免费且可自由定制
项目采用 MIT 开源协议,完全免费。MIT 协议是目前最宽松的开源许可证之一,由麻省理工学院(Massachusetts Institute of Technology)创立。它允许任何人免费使用、复制、修改、合并、发布、分发、再授权和销售软件副本,唯一的要求是保留原始版权声明。相比之下,GPL 协议要求衍生作品也必须开源,Apache 协议则包含专利授权条款。选择 MIT 协议意味着你可以根据自己的喜好修改翻译词条、调整提示颜色、定制命令说明,甚至基于此开发自己的工具链,真正做到"你的 Claude Code 你做主"。
AI 自适应,告别版本更新后的重复劳动
由于汉化过程由 Claude Code 自身执行,即使工具版本更新,只要重新运行一次汉化指令,AI 就能根据新版本的文件结构自动完成适配,省去了等待第三方汉化包更新的时间。需要注意的是,每次通过 npm update 更新 Claude Code 时,之前的汉化修改会被新版本文件覆盖,但重新执行一次汉化指令即可恢复,整个过程通常只需几十秒。
总结:AI 自服务的汉化新思路
这个汉化方案的核心价值不仅在于解决了中文化的问题,更在于它展示了一种 "AI 自服务" 的思路:与其费力制作兼容各版本的汉化补丁,不如让 AI 工具自己理解需求、自己完成修改。这种模式的可扩展性远超传统方案——同样的思路可以应用于其他语言的本地化、界面主题定制,甚至功能扩展,只要你能提供一份足够清晰的"说明书",AI agent 就能自主完成执行。
对于国内开发者来说,降低 AI 编程工具的使用门槛,让更多人能无障碍地上手 Claude Code,这本身就是一件有价值的事情。如果你一直因为英文界面而对 Claude Code 犹豫不决,不妨试试这个方案。
相关推荐
教程攻略Cursor+Codex双IDE协同:开源项目二开实战方法论
基于实战经验总结的开源项目二次开发完整方法论,详解Cursor+Codex双IDE协同工作流,涵盖二开七环节、MVP验证、AI读源码技巧,帮助开发者三天跑通项目、两周完成业务集成。
教程攻略Cursor多Agent实战:50分钟搭建Next.js全栈博客
使用Cursor IDE多Agent协作模式,50分钟内从零搭建全栈博客。涵盖Next.js、Clerk认证、Supabase数据库集成,详解4个AI Agent分阶段开发流程与关键避坑经验。
教程攻略从零搭建AI软件工厂:Cursor工程师的多Agent协作实战经验
Cursor工程师Eric分享AI软件工厂构建实战:从自动化六层级、护栏设计、并行Agent管理到规模化扩展,详解如何用多Agent协作实现7×24小时高效软件开发。